Sound of the Netherlands is a project of the Netherlands Institute for Sound and Vision, the Auditieve DienstΒ and Kennisland, which was supported by the digitization program Images for the Future. More than 2,000 of the historical sounds are so-called βown recordingsβ from the sound archive of Sound and Vision, including many "lost soundsβ, and are made online accessible to a wide audience. In addition, anyone can add sounds via the online platform or the βSound Hunter-appβ for iPhone and Android devices. The collection of historical sounds and the new sounds are online available for consultation and reuse under the Creative Commons license Attribution-ShareAlike. To stimulate contributions to and reuse of the collection several events were organised, like workshops and contests.
